
Quick Improvement: Immediately replace the generic title "Delivery Driver" with "E-commerce Delivery Driver - DAFZA" at the top of your CV. This instantly signals your specific location and sector expertise to recruiters.
Skills Optimization: Beyond "driving," list skills critical for e-commerce: "Last-Mile E-commerce Delivery," "DAFZA Free Zone Navigation," "Contactless Delivery Procedures," and "Real-Time Parcel Tracking Updates."
Example: Instead of "Delivered packages," write: "Executed time-sensitive e-commerce deliveries within the DAFZA free zone, ensuring 99% on-time rate for premium client parcels."
Mistake: Don't treat all delivery experience as equal. Failing to separate and highlight your specific e-commerce and DAFZA experience gets your CV overlooked.
Advanced Tip: If you've handled returns or managed customer queries via an app, include it as "E-commerce Reverse Logistics" or "In-App Customer Service Coordination."

Quick Improvement: Create a dedicated "Key Skills" section right after your profile. Populate it with a mix of hard skills (GPS Routing Apps, E-waybill Processing) and soft skills (Punctuality, Professional Appearance) prized in e-commerce.
Skills Optimization: Emphasize technology use. Include "E-commerce Delivery App Proficiency (e.g., Cheetah, Deliveroo, Talabat)," "Digital POD (Proof of Delivery) ," and "Basic Troubleshooting of Delivery Tablets/Phones."
Example: A strong skill list would be: DAFZA Route Planning, Fragile & High-Value Goods Handling, Cash-on-Delivery (COD) Accuracy, and Fluency in English and a second language common in DAFZA.

Advanced Tip: Mention knowledge of DAFZA's specific security and access procedures, showing you can navigate the zone's unique logistics efficiently.

Quick Improvement: Quantify everything. Use numbers for parcels delivered per day, on-time delivery percentages, and customer satisfaction ratings if available from past app-based work.
Skills Optimization: Highlight customer interaction skills specific to modern e-commerce: "Professional Client Liaison at Point of Delivery," "Discreet Handling of High-Value Deliveries," and "Adherence to Brand-Specific Delivery Protocols."
Example: Under experience, write: "Managed an average of 60+ e-commerce deliveries daily within DAFZA, maintaining a 4.9/5 customer service rating on the company's internal platform."
Mistake: Writing long paragraphs about duties. Use 3-5 clear, bulleted achievements per role instead.
Advanced Tip: If you have experience with temperature-controlled deliveries (food, pharmaceuticals) in DAFZA, create a separate bullet point to highlight this niche skill.

Quick Improvement: Add a 2-3 line professional profile summarizing your role: "Reliable E-commerce Delivery Driver with [X] years of experience ensuring efficient last-mile logistics within the DAFZA free zone. Skilled in..."
Skills Optimization: Include compliance and safety skills: "Defensive Driving Certified," "Knowledge of UAE Traffic Laws," "Vehicle Safety Inspection Routines," and "DAFZA Protocol Compliance."
Example: A good profile statement: "Detail-oriented delivery professional specializing in fast-paced e-commerce operations in DAFZA. Committed to providing secure, punctual, and customer-focused service for high-volume clients."

Advanced Tip: Mention any training completed, such as safe lifting techniques or customer service workshops, as this shows proactive professional development.

Quick Improvement: Use clean, modern formatting with clear headers. Avoid colorful templates. Save your CV as "YourName_DAFZA_Ecommerce_Driver.pdf" before sending.
Skills Optimization: Demonstrate reliability and problem-solving: "Route Optimization for Fuel & Time Efficiency," "Effective Communication with Dispatch & Warehouse Teams," and "Independent Problem Resolution for Delivery Issues."
Example: For problem-solving, write: "Resolved address ambiguities in DAFZA by proactively contacting customers and using zone maps, reducing failed deliveries by 15%."
Mistake: Omitting key details like your UAE driving license category (often Light Motor Vehicle) and its expiration date, which is a fundamental requirement.
Advanced Tip: If you aspire to a team lead or supervisor role, include any mentoring of new drivers or informal coordination you've done, framing it as "Operational Support."
